Albania vs Cyprus statistics compared

Updated on by Georank team

Albania has a population of 2.38M (ranked 144/197), compared with 1.36M in Cyprus (ranked 155/197). Albania's land area is 10,579 sq mi versus 3,568 sq mi for Cyprus (ranked 143rd vs. 163rd).

By GDP, Albania ranks 112/197 ($27B) and Cyprus ranks 103/197 ($37.6B). By GDP per capita, Albania ranks 82/197 ($11,378), while Cyprus ranks 45/197 ($27,707).
